'Perez strong enough to take on Verstappen'

Max Verstappen has been driving for Red Bull Racing for a few years now and that puts him in an important position with the team - thanks to his successes. In recent years he hasn't really had the support of a teammate on track due to the departure of Daniel Ricciardo, but that may be different this year with Sergio Perez taking Alexander Albon 's place. Perez will also be a formidable opponent for Verstappen according to Jenson Button. He'll get the most out of the car In an interview with Sky Sports Button was asked how he views the situation and if Perez will take the role of second driver.
